WebOne Asian pear fruit contains: Calories: 51. Protein: 1 gram. Fat: Less than 1 gram. Carbohydrates: 13 grams. Fiber: 4 grams. Sugar: 9 grams. WebNov 4, 2024 · Dietary fiber — found mainly in fruits, vegetables, whole grains and legumes — is probably best known for its ability to prevent or relieve constipation. But foods containing fiber can provide other health benefits as well, such as helping to maintain a healthy weight and lowering your risk of diabetes, heart disease and some types of cancer.
